Copper Anodes Market Analysis:

The copper anodes market is primarily influenced by the expansion of the electronics industry, which heavily relies on copper anodes for circuitry and other components. In line with this, continual advancements in electroplating technologies enhance the efficiency and application range of copper anodes, broadening their usage in various manufacturing processes and driving market growth. Moreover, the automotive sector's increasing adoption of electric vehicles necessitates more copper anodes for battery production and other electrical components, catalyzing market demand. Considerable growth in infrastructure development, particularly in emerging economies, requires substantial copper anode inputs for construction and electrical fittings, further propelling market reach.

Besides this, regulatory trends towards sustainable and environmentally friendly materials promote the use of copper due to its recyclability, supporting market expansion. Similarly, increasing innovations in alloy compositions make copper anodes more effective for specific industrial applications, thereby diversifying the market. In addition to this, geopolitical factors are affecting copper supply chains, influencing anode prices and market stability. Likewise, the development of new mining technologies is reducing the cost of copper extraction, potentially lowering input costs for anode manufacturing and increasing market accessibility.

Copper anodes manufacturing requires raw materials such as copper concentrate, which is then processed through smelting to create impure blister copper. Other materials like recycled copper scrap, copper foils, and high-purity copper cathodes are also used.

A copper anodes factory typically requires copper smelting furnaces, anode casting molds, refining kettles, electrolytic refining tanks, cathode stripping machines, anode scrap washing systems, cranes, conveyors, dust collectors, gas scrubbers, and water treatment units.

The main steps generally include:

  • Copper ore concentration and preparation

  • Smelting to produce blister copper

  • Fire refining to remove impurities

  • Casting copper into anode molds

  • Cooling and solidifying anode plates

  • Surface cleaning and trimming anodes

  • Quality inspection and storage for electrolysis

  • Packaging and distribution

Usually, the timeline can range from 18 to 24 months to start a copper anodes manufacturing plant, depending on factors like site development, machinery installation, environmental clearances, safety measures, and trial runs.
